Subject: Cut-over done — export memory

Hey, quick wrap-up: we flipped Tallygrove's spreadsheet export to the new streaming writer tonight. Peak memory dropped from ~4 GB to under 600 MB on the big ledger exports. Watch heap alerts for the next 24h just in case. The current settings for the export service are below.

deployment values, bahof-badug:
[rusix]
team = zorok
access_code = ac_641cbe
owner = ulair.tamius
host = rusix.torvasoft.local
port = 5672
peer = ulaix.sivrelworks.internal
salt = 1df570ed
pin = 6327

Currency-Hedging Decision — Managers Only

This page records the board-level rationale for Ashgrove Maritime's decision to hedge 70% of projected thaler-denominated receivables for the next four quarters using forward contracts. Treasury modelled three scenarios; the chosen structure limits downside exposure to an acceptable band while preserving partial upside. Costs are within the approved hedging budget, and counterparty limits were reviewed by the risk committee. The confidential commercial reasoning behind the hedge ratio is noted below.

confidential, kagup-bafog: Fraaxax Group is in early talks to buy Soroxox Group for about $343.8 million. The Olidor launch date is June 14, and nothing goes to the press before then. Legal wants the Aldmirek Logistics term sheet signed before July 23.

**Alert: StatFunnel sidecar flush latency elevated**

This fires when the StatFunnel metrics-aggregation sidecar takes longer than 30 seconds to flush its buffer to the Corvid pipeline. Usually it means the downstream ingest queue is backed up, not that the sidecar itself is broken. Check queue depth first before restarting anything. Step-by-step triage instructions for new folks are on the internal page here:

runbook for badug-kadup: https://confluence.zemvarlabs.internal/projects/browse/display/projects/bd1b

- [ ] **Step 7: Breaker override escrow.** After sealing the signing keys for the Tallgrove upstream API circuit breaker, confirm the support team can force the breaker open during a full outage. The override bundle lives in the sealed escrow drawer and is useless without its unlock phrase. Two ceremony witnesses must initial this step before proceeding. The escrow bundle is decrypted with the recovery passphrase that follows.

vault phrase of kahip-kahop = holath-quenmir